Drip Irrigation: Making The Most Of Effectiveness and Reducing Waste



Leak Irrigation stands apart as one of one of the most reliable techniques for supplying water straight to the origins of plants, making certain that marginal water is shed to dissipation or overflow. This system uses a network of tubes and emitters to supply a specific and regular supply of water, adapting to the details needs of various plants. By concentrating on the root area, drip Irrigation not just conserves water however likewise promotes much healthier plant development and greater returns.


Furthermore, this method reduces the risk of dirt disintegration and nutrient leaching, contributing to better dirt wellness. Contrasted to traditional Irrigation approaches, drip Irrigation significantly lowers water intake, making it a lasting option for agriculture, specifically in dry regions. Its ability to integrate with numerous soil kinds and plant varieties better enhances its versatility, making it a necessary device in promoting ecological sustainability and accountable water management in farming techniques.


Smart Irrigation Systems: Harnessing Information for Better Resource Monitoring



While typical Irrigation methods often count on set timetables that may not represent varying weather or plant needs, wise Irrigation systems leverage progressed modern technology to enhance water usage. These systems use sensing units, climate information, and dirt dampness readings to make real-time modifications, ensuring that water is provided precisely when and where it is required. By analyzing environmental problems, wise Irrigation can minimize water usage substantially while maintaining crop health and wellness.


In addition, these systems frequently incorporate with mobile applications, permitting farmers to monitor and manage their Irrigation from another location. This data-driven method not just boosts resource management but likewise advertises sustainable agricultural methods. Consequently, clever Irrigation systems add to reduced water waste, lower operational expenses, and improved plant returns. In a period of raising water deficiency, their implementation represents a significant step toward achieving environmental sustainability in agriculture.


The Function of Rainwater Harvesting in Sustainable Agriculture



Exactly how can rainwater harvesting change agricultural techniques? This method captures and stores rainwater for agricultural use, substantially boosting water schedule and advertising lasting farming techniques. By efficiently using rain, farmers lower dependency on traditional water sources, therefore saving groundwater and surface area water products. Rainwater collecting systems can be adapted to different scales, from small home arrangements to bigger community projects, making them available to diverse agricultural setups.


The assimilation of rain harvesting contributes to look here dirt conservation by minimizing disintegration and boosting dirt moisture retention. This technique likewise helps minimize the effects of droughts and uneven rainfall patterns, which are progressively common as a result of climate change. Generally, rainwater harvesting functions as a proactive strategy in sustainable agriculture, promoting water resilience and advertising ecological sustainability while supporting the resources of farmers.
